What Are Transmission Problems?
Definition and Function of the Transmission
Your car's transmission is a crucial component, acting because the bridge between your engine's energy and the wheels. It manages the engine's rotational velocity, allowing you to smoothly accelerate, decelerate, and navigate totally different terrains. With Out a properly functioning transmission, your car merely would not transfer effectively, or in any respect. Assume of it like a gearbox in a bicycle; it permits you to change gears to swimsuit completely different speeds and gradients. In automobiles, it is a far more complex system, handling far greater power and requiring precise synchronization.

Common Causes of Transmission Problems
Low or Contaminated Transmission Fluid
Transmission fluid serves because the lifeblood of your automatic transmission, lubricating and cooling internal elements. Low fluid ranges, because of leaks or improper maintenance, can cause friction, overheating, and premature wear. Contaminated fluid, containing particles or particles, can equally damage delicate inner elements. Often checking your transmission fluid level and condition is crucial preventive maintenance, simply carried out with the help of your proprietor's manual and a simple dipstick check. Wear and Tear of Transmission Components
Over time, like all mechanical system, transmissions experience put on and tear. This is especially true for older autos or these subjected to heavy use or harsh driving conditions. Elements like clutches, bands, and gears can wear down, resulting in decreased performance and eventual failure. Common maintenance and careful driving can help extend the life of your transmission, however eventually, some components will need substitute. This is a pure process that cannot be totally averted, although proper maintenance can actually prolong its lifespan.
Faulty Transmission Solenoids or Sensors
Modern transmissions rely heavily on digital controls, together with solenoids and sensors. These components regulate fluid flow and shift timing. Malfunctions in these electronic components can result in irregular shifting, harsh engagement, or complete transmission failure. A diagnostic scan can usually pinpoint these issues, a service readily available at most auto repair shops in areas like Richmond, Delta, and New Westminster.
Mechanical Failures and Inner Damage
Sometimes, internal elements inside the transmission may fail due to manufacturing defects, extreme wear, or damage from low fluid ranges or contamination. This can vary from broken gears to broken planetary sets, requiring in depth repairs or a whole transmission replacement. Recognizing the signs early, corresponding to unusual grinding or knocking noises, is crucial for minimizing the extent of injury.
External Elements like Overheating or Poor Maintenance
Overheating is a serious enemy of computerized transmissions. Prolonged operation under heavy loads, towing, or driving in excessive warmth can result in significant injury. Neglecting routine maintenance, such as rare fluid changes, also can contribute to untimely failure. Recognizing the Indicators of Transmission Problems
Slipping Gears and Erratic Shifting
A widespread symptom is the sensation that your transmission is slipping or not engaging properly. Gears might not engage smoothly, or the car may rev unexpectedly without corresponding acceleration. This is normally a delicate signal at first but will worsen over time if left unaddressed.
Delayed Engagement or Difficulty Starting
If your car hesitates before participating into gear, or if there's issue getting the car to move from a standstill, your transmission might be struggling. This delay can be more pronounced in cold weather, but when it's a consistent problem, skilled help is advisable.
Unusual Noises (Grinding, Whining)
Grinding, whining, or humming noises coming from the transmission area indicate potential points. These noises usually signify metal-on-metal contact or broken parts inside the transmission. They are often a clear indication that an issue wants instant consideration.
Fluid Leaks or Burning Smell
Leaking transmission fluid is a major problem. It can lead to low fluid levels and damage to internal components. A distinctive burning smell, typically accompanied by smoke, suggests overheating and certain fluid degradation. These point out a critical situation needing pressing consideration.
Dashboard Warning Lights
Modern automobiles typically have transmission warning lights on the dashboard. These should by no means be ignored. If a warning gentle illuminates, it’s a critical sign that one thing is incorrect and desires immediate attention to forestall additional damage.
Diagnosing Transmission Issues
Visual Inspection and Fluid Checks
A visible inspection can generally reveal external leaks or harm. Checking the transmission fluid degree and situation (color, smell, clarity) is a simple but important first step. Low fluid, burnt fluid or unusual debris point out inside issues.
Use of Diagnostic Tools (OBD-II Scanners)
OBD-II scanners can read di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s) stored throughout the automobile's pc system. These codes can present priceless insights into the precise nature of the transmission concern. Many auto parts shops provide OBD-II scanner leases.

Preventive Measures and Maintenance Tips
Regular Transmission Fluid Changes
Following the manufacturer's recommended schedule for transmission fluid and filter changes is crucial for stopping untimely wear and tear. Using the proper type and quantity of fluid can be important.
Monitoring for Early Symptoms
Pay shut attention to how your automobile shifts and hear for any unusual noises. Early detection of problems can prevent cash and prevent main repairs down the highway.
Proper Driving Habits to Scale Back Stress
Avoid aggressive driving habits, such as fast acceleration and harsh braking. These actions put undue stress on the transmission. Clean driving habits will prolong transmission health.

When to Repair or Replace the Transmission
Assessing the Severity of the Problem
The severity of the problem will decide whether repair or substitute is important. Minor points could solely require fluid modifications or solenoid replacements. Major inside harm typically necessitates an entire rebuild or alternative.
Cost-Benefit Evaluation of Repairs vs. Replacement
Weigh the value of repairs in opposition to the value of a alternative transmission. Sometimes, a rebuild or replacement might be less expensive than extensive repairs, especially for older autos.
